This method fused the romantic style of the french ballet and dramatic soulfulness of the russian character with the athletic virtuosity that characterizes the italian school to reform the old imperial style of ballet teaching. Chapters cover battements, rotary movements of the legs, the arms, poses of the classical dance, connecting and auxiliary movements, jumps, beats, point work, and turns as well as material for a sample lesson. The principles although the stars of russian ballet anna pavlova and tamara karsavina possessed a national manner of dancing, there was no truly russian school of dancing until the 1930s. The five basic positions are usually one of the first things taught in a beginners ballet class but are essential to the technique of classical ballet as practically every step begins and ends in one of the five basic positions. A precise technique and system of instruction, vaganova emphasized dancing with the entire body, promoting harmonious movement among arms, legs, and torso.
